A Tale of Two Giants: Honeywell vs. U-Haul

In the world of industrial and consumer services, Honeywell International Inc. and U-Haul Holding Company stand as titans. Over the past decade, Honeywell has consistently outperformed U-Haul in terms of gross profit, with an average of nearly 12 billion annually, compared to U-Haul's 3.6 billion. Honeywell's peak came in 2023, with a staggering 13.7 billion, marking a 20% increase from 2014. Meanwhile, U-Haul's growth trajectory is notable, with a 100% increase from 2014 to 2022, peaking at 5.5 billion. However, 2024 data for Honeywell is missing, leaving room for speculation.
